Finding GCD of 502, 397, 570, 117 using Prime Factorization

Given Input Data is 502, 397, 570, 117

Make a list of Prime Factors of all the given numbers initially

Prime Factorization of 502 is 2 x 251

Prime Factorization of 397 is 397

Prime Factorization of 570 is 2 x 3 x 5 x 19

Prime Factorization of 117 is 3 x 3 x 13

The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1
